// SWEEP_GRACE_HOURS: minimum age before the Tidewell sweeper
// may delete an orphaned resource. Orphans are volumes and
// snapshots whose owning workload no longer exists in the
// Karsten registry. Lowering this below 6 caused data loss in
// the Oakmere incident — restores were still attaching. Raise
// it freely; never lower without a migration plan. The build
// token for the release that set this value is recorded below.

build token for fajof-yahof: htk4_869f

## Runbook: Test Account Recovery — Payvern Integration Suite

Context for weekly eng sync: the flaky integration tests in the Payvern payments service often stem from the shared sandbox account getting locked by concurrent runs. When the suite reports repeated auth failures, do not retry blindly — lockouts compound. Instead, recover the sandbox account from the staging console, then re-run only the affected suite. Recovery requires the account's passphrase, rotated quarterly by the platform team. Use the recovery passphrase below.

vault phrase of taweg-kafof = oliax-zorael

## Limits & Quotas

Heads up, plugin folks: the `snapsqueeze` CLI enforces hard caps on batch jobs so one runaway plugin can't flatten the render pool. Exceed a cap and you'll get a `QUOTA_EXCEEDED` exit code — no partial output, no retries on our side, so handle it gracefully. Caps apply per invocation, not per day, and they differ between the free and Atelier tiers. Current defaults are set by these constants.

tuning constants:
QUOTAS = {
    "julwyn": 448,
    "belix": 11,
}

## Runbook: Sproutwise watering scheduler

The Sproutwise scheduler dispatches watering jobs to the greenhouse valve controllers at Thornmere every six hours. If jobs stop firing, first check that the controller heartbeat is current, then confirm the scheduler process itself is healthy before touching valve firmware. A full restart clears stuck job leases but resets the moisture-averaging window, so only do this off-peak. After any restart, verify the service came back with the expected configuration values, listed here:

settings of fafog-haduf:
ZORIX_PIN=4648
ZORIX_METRICS_HOST=metrics.zorix.paliqsys.corp
ZORIX_LOG_LEVEL=info
ZORIX_TENANT=druix